Matteo Berrettini had a rather unusual 2024 season. Back from injury, the Italian colossus had a rollercoaster year, with his body complicating his task on several occasions. Despite this, he enjoyed several moments of glory, winning three ATP titles (Marrakech, Gstaad, Kitzbuhel) and playing a major role in Italy's Davis Cup triumph.

In comments relayed by our colleagues at Ubitennis, Berrettini seems to have rediscovered his motivation and will to win. He warned his rivals that he has big ambitions for 2025: "Now I'm resting for a week and I've got a very tight schedule ahead of me, but this year has made me realize a lot of things.

We're lucky enough to play with and against the best player in the world, which always motivates us. The aim is to get as close to him as possible. I'm capable of doing that."
